The visionary game developer, the mind behind the globally famous franchise Call of Duty, has passed away in a car accident in California at the age of 55.

Zampella's death was verified by Electronic Arts, which owns Respawn Entertainment, the development studio which he helped establish.

The celebrated video game developer passed away following his car crashed and burst into flames on a motorway in LA on Sunday, according to.

"This represents a devastating loss, and we stand with his family and friends, those closest to him, and all those touched by his creative vision," a spokesperson for Electronic Arts stated.
